Most parents recognize the need for prevention regarding their children's physical health and safety, yet many overlook the importance of emotional and behavioral prevention. Dr. Lawrence E. Shapiro emphasizes that parents often wait for symptoms to arise before taking action. However, many issues can be addressed proactively if parents know what to look for. Preventing emotional problems is far easier than treating them once they disrupt a child's life. Dr. Shapiro offers imaginative and effective strategies for navigating critical moments in a child's emotional development, from infancy through adolescence. He guides parents in identifying risks for issues like depression, underachievement, shyness, eating disorders, and ADHD, while providing actionable advice. Some suggestions may seem like common sense—such as instilling healthy eating habits early to prevent future disorders—while others may be surprising, like not coddling fearful babies or avoiding excessive praise for toddlers. Engaging in a teenager's education, even when they seem distant, is also crucial. This resource is filled with practical examples and advice, equipping parents with the skills to help their children build resilience against the challenges of today. By providing "an ounce of prevention" daily, parents can significantly enhance their child's happiness and well-being.
